#84 - J Dilla: Godfather of Lo-Fi Beatmaking and Pioneer of Black Music Production


Listen Later

What made J Dilla a trailblazing producer? In this episode, we pay homage to his life and work, exploring his significance in lo-fi beatmaking and black music production. We also discuss how his style differed from the harder hitting beats of his east coast contemporaries.

Important questions:

  • How did J Dilla become a pioneer in lo-fi beatmaking? What made J Dilla's production style unique, and how did he use the MPC to create complex, textured beats with a laid-back, groovy feel?
  • How did J Dilla's style differ from the hard-hitting beats that were prevalent in the east coast hip-hop scene during his time? How did this contribute to a more nuanced and intricate sound?
  • What was J Dilla's influence on hip-hop and black music production, and how did he help to shape the sound of modern hip-hop and R&B?
